Can we use a gaming mouse for normal use?

Yes — you can absolutely use a gaming mouse for normal, everyday computer use. In fact, many people prefer it over a regular mouse because of its comfort, precision, and extra features.


🖱️ Using a Gaming Mouse for Normal Tasks

1. Comfort & Ergonomics

Gaming mice are designed for long sessions, so they often provide better hand support and reduce fatigue while browsing, working, or studying.

2. Precision

High-quality sensors allow smooth, accurate cursor movements, which can be helpful for web browsing, document editing, graphic design, or photo editing.

3. Extra Buttons & Customization

Programmable buttons can be assigned to shortcuts like copy/paste, switching tabs, or opening apps — making everyday tasks faster.

4. Durability

Gaming mice are built to withstand millions of clicks, so they tend to last longer than standard office mice.

5. Adjustable DPI

DPI (cursor sensitivity) can be changed for precise movements in tasks like design work or fast navigation during normal use.


⚠️ Things to Consider

  • Price: Gaming mice are usually more expensive than standard mice.

  • Aesthetics: RGB lighting may be unnecessary for work, but most models allow you to turn it off.

  • Overkill for Simple Tasks: If you only occasionally browse the web, the extra features might not be essential.


✅ Bottom Line

A gaming mouse works perfectly well for normal use and often provides better comfort, precision, and functionality than a regular mouse. It’s a versatile option for both work and play.
